About Oxley 2903

The size of Oxley is approximately 1.1 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 25.6% of total area. The population of Oxley in 2016 was 1693 people. By 2021 the population was 1703 showing a population growth of 0.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Oxley is 50-59 years. Households in Oxley are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Oxley work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 75.90% of the homes in Oxley were owner-occupied compared with 73.30% in 2016.

Oxley has 654 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Oxley have seen a 28.10%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 6.17%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Oxley is $1,021,748 while the median value for Units is $682,800.
  • Houses have a median rent of $640 while Units have a median rent of $410.
There are currently no proper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Oxley on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 24 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Oxley.
